National Ecology Day 2024
This project officially launched on 1 July 2024. As 15 August every year has been designated as "National Ecology Day," the project organisation organised two free eco-tours for the public at the Mai Po Nature Reserve on 16 August 2024, to respond to and enhance public awareness of ecological civilisation and environmental protection. Participants first learned about the importance of the Deep Bay mudflats and Gei Wais to the ecological environment. Subsequently, the speaker introduced participants to modern technologies, such as how the Internet of Things and wireless technology can be applied in conservation work. For example, water level sensors and water quality monitors are installed at multiple locations within the Mai Po Nature Reserve to remotely obtain real-time, precise water level and quality data, allowing for timely management actions. Last but not least, under the guidance of interpreters, participants explored and experienced this wetland habitat with its unique biodiversity in person.
